Output 29aaac59ebdebe9102f857743764c37686a22d265fe9333da9279cdd9c30ec3e:5

value
158936
script pubkey
OP_0 OP_PUSHBYTES_20 af29ca447d991b992fbccc975ee354cc7418693d
address
bc1q4u5u53ranydejtauejt4ac65e36ps6fafw0uhw
transaction
29aaac59ebdebe9102f857743764c37686a22d265fe9333da9279cdd9c30ec3e
spent
true